Become a Savvy Locator
You don’t need to drive around the block endlessly or become a detective to find the best local stores. Start by checking out community boards, local websites or apps like Yelp. You can also join local social media groups where people often share their favorite spots.
- Use Google Maps to find nearby local stores and read reviews.
- Don’t hesitate to ask locals for recommendations—that includes those charming bookstore owners or café baristas!
- Visit local farmers markets, which can act as a hub for finding various local vendors.
Compare Quality and Prices Smartly
It’s easy to assume local goods are pricier, but that’s not always true. Often, you’re paying for quality and craftsmanship. Here’s how to ensure you’re getting a great deal with value:
- Know the standard price range: Familiarize yourself with prices from big stores and bring business cards from places with good deals for a quick comparison.
- Talk to the seller: Ask about the sourcing, production methods, and any promotions they might have.
- Look for value over price: Consider the longevity and quality of the product.

Navigating Concerns and Common Questions
Switching from chain stores to local shopping can leave you with some questions, or *a lot* if we’re being honest. Let’s tackle a few:
- Product Availability: It’s great news for local shops to be sold out sometimes—it means they offer popular goods! Ask when they expect stock restocks or if they can keep something aside for you.
- Payment Options: Many local businesses now accept various payment methods like cards, mobile payments, etc. But it’s always good to keep some cash in hand—bonus, you might avoid that ATM fee.
Boost the Local Economy
By shopping locally, you’re not just buying a product. You’re investing in your community. Each purchase helps the local economy, creating jobs and keeping your city vibrant.
Statistics from the American Independent Business Alliance show that local businesses put a larger share of their revenue back into the local economy compared to chain stores. Talk about shopping with an impact!
